2. Top Types of Rides Offering Photo Stops
Various ride formats incorporate mid-ride photo opportunities, each delivering unique ways to capture moments.
Scenic Train or Tram Tours
These slow-moving rides often pause at scenic vistas or wildlife spots, offering ample chances for photos. The natural backdrops provide stunning imagery without the rush of typical thrill rides.
Themed Dark Rides and Storybook Attractions
Some theme parks integrate photo moments during key scenes in dark rides, capturing guests' reactions to surprises or character encounters, enhancing the narrative with visual mementos.
Ferris Wheels and Observation Rides
Though not always mid-ride photo stops, many ferris wheels slow at vantage points to allow riders to pose and take photos, blending the ride experience with photography.
3. Benefits of Mid-Ride Photo Opportunities for Visitors
Offering photo opportunities mid-ride benefits visitors in multiple ways beyond simple souvenir photos.
Enhanced Engagement and Enjoyment
Knowing a photo moment is coming encourages visitors to be more present and expressive during the ride, enriching their emotional connection to the experience.
Convenience and Accessibility
Capturing photos without the need to bring personal cameras or phones mid-ride allows everyone, including children and those with limited mobility, to enjoy memorable snapshots effortlessly.
Boosting Social Sharing and Park Promotion
These photos often become cherished social media posts, organically promoting the ride and park while fostering a community of enthusiasts sharing their experiences.

5. Tips for Capturing the Best Mid-Ride Photos
While many rides handle photography professionally, visitors can enhance their experience with some simple tips.
Express Genuine Emotion
Relax and enjoy the moment; authentic smiles and reactions create the best photos.
Coordinate Outfits and Accessories
Matching colors or themed accessories can make photos more visually appealing and memorable.
Stay Ready and Alert
Mid-ride photo opportunities can happen suddenly, so be prepared to smile or pose quickly without stress.
